A pair of 19th Century bronzes by the French sculpture Louis- Marie Moris (1818-1883) Each bronze depicts two classical warriors in combat, the first scene is of a warrior seated on a rearing horse wearing a helmet and wielding a battle axe, the other on foot with a sword at his side, with his helmet and shield on the floor, the second scene is with both warriors wearing their helmets, with one warrior on his horse with no weapon whilst the other warrior is on foot wielding a battle axe, both scenes are on a naturalistic oval base and both are signed to one side MORIS. The bronzes are in excellent condition and are of a green patina.
16" x 9" x 20" high.
41cms x 23cms x 51cms high.
